The restaurant Athina Grill in Seattle’s vibrant Uptown neighborhood is a charming Greek restaurant that invites you to a delightful culinary journey. You’ll discover a cozy and casual atmosphere perfect for enjoying authentic Greek flavors.
Whether you’re seeking healthy options, a quick bite, or a relaxed dinner, this spot offers a diverse menu including small plates and vegetarian options, complemented by a selection of wine, beer, and coffee.
Athina Grill offers a generally pleasant dining experience, often praised for its fresh and delicious food, with many noting the consistency in quality. Guests frequently appreciate the friendly and attentive service, making for a welcoming visit.
The atmosphere is often described as cozy with fun decor, contributing to a comfortable setting. However, some experiences at Athina Grill have been less favorable, with concerns raised about the falafel being inedible or dry meat.
There are also mentions of long wait times and a feeling that the value can be pricey for the quality received, suggesting some inconsistencies in the overall offering.

Athina Grill holds a respectable overall score of 7.1, indicating a generally good experience. However, customer satisfaction sits at 69.8%, which falls into the mixed category.
This suggests that while many find it good, a notable portion of diners have reservations. This assessment is drawn from over 361 customer opinions, with 252 positive remarks balancing against 93 negative ones, painting a nuanced picture.
Looking closer, Service (7.9) and Ambience (7.9) stand out as strong points, consistently receiving positive feedback. The Food (6.8) is generally well-regarded, though it hovers at the edge of the “good” range, suggesting some room for improvement.
Similarly, Value (6.8) also falls into this mid-range, with opinions split on whether the pricing aligns with the overall quality.
With a recommendation score of 7.1, Athina Grill presents a mixed but generally positive picture. It’s a place worth considering if you appreciate warm service and a comfortable setting, especially for its fresh Greek dishes.
However, be mindful of potential inconsistencies in food quality and pricing. If you’re seeking a casual Greek meal and aren’t in a rush, Athina Grill could be a good fit.
It offers a decent experience, but managing expectations regarding value and occasional service delays will help ensure a more satisfying visit.
When it comes to the food, theres a lot to talk about! Many guests rave about the "fresh, " "delicious, " and "flavorful" dishes, often highlighting "generous portions" and "nicely prepared" meals. With 155 positive remarks out of 237 total opinions, it seems many leave satisfied, contributing to a solid 6.8 score.
However, the experience isnt universally stellar, as reflected by a mixed 65.4% customer satisfaction. Some diners encountered dry or bland food, with complaints about small portion sizes and the use of canned ingredients, accounting for 73 negative comments. It appears consistency might be a bit of a challenge here.

When it comes to service, this spot generally shines, boasting a strong score of 7.9 and a solid 80.7% customer satisfaction. Many guests consistently praise the friendly and attentive staff, often highlighting how quick to serve they are and the helpfulness of the waitstaff. With 46 positive comments, it seems most experiences are quite pleasant.
However, its not always perfect. A handful of guests, in 8 remarks, have pointed out concerns like long waiting times and a feeling of basic service being lacking. Some even mentioned staff seeming annoyed or servers being inattentive, indicating theres still a bit of inconsistency to iron out.

When it comes to the overall vibe, this spot generally hits the mark! With a solid score of 7.9 and customer satisfaction at 83.3%, the ambience here is definitely good. Many guests, accounting for 35 positive remarks out of 42 total, loved the cozy atmosphere, cute interior, and great decor, often highlighting the warm and inviting feel, sometimes even with nice music and a quiet noise level.
However, not everyone had a perfect experience, with 6 negative comments pointing out some issues. A few found the place to be freezing cold or too dark due to burned-out light bulbs. There were also mentions of a strong smell of cigarette smoke and the restaurant feeling very well dated, which detracted from the overall atmosphere for some.

Many diners found plenty to cheer about regarding value, with 16 positive comments out of 25 total. Guests frequently praised the fair price and great price, often noting the Good value for the amount of food received. The overall score for value sits at a respectable 6.8, indicating a generally good experience, though customer satisfaction is a bit more mixed at 64%.
However, not everyone was convinced, with 6 negative observations. Some diners felt it was Pricey for the quality or even price gouged, struggling to justify the cost of certain dishes. A few experiences suggested that the value didn't always align with expectations, leading to some disappointment.

You’re looking at roughly 20 per person – reported by 41 diners. That puts it in the $11–$20 category. For a Greek Restaurant, it’s comfortably mid-range: not a steal, but not bank-breaking either.
Looking at what people actually spend, most guests stick to this $11–$20 range, with 29 out of 41 reviews falling here. A few folks venture into the $21–$30 or even 31 – 50 $ brackets, but the sweet spot is definitely around the 20 mark.
